.Find dy/dx by implicit differentiation.y^5 +x^2y^3 = 1 +ye^x2

Answers

Answer:

(2xye^x²  -  2xy³) / (5y^4  + 3y²x² - e^x²)

Step-by-step explanation:

differentiate each term:

d/dx (y^5) + d/dx (x² y³) = d/dx (1) + d/dx (ye^x²)

any time y is differentiated, make sure to include dy/dx:

5y^4 dy/dx  +  2xy³ + 3y²x² dy/dx  = 0 + e^x² dy/dx + 2xye^x²

collect terms with dy/dx:

dy/dx (5y^4 + 3y²x² - e^x²)  =  2xye^x² - 2xy³

divide both sides  by  (5y^4 + 3y²x² - e^x²):

dy/dx = (2xye^x²  -  2xy³) / (5y^4  + 3y²x² - e^x²)

iq scores in a certain population are normally distributed. it is given that: (1) 13% of people have iq that does not exceed 80. (2) mensa is an organization whose members have iqs in the top 3% of the population. the minimum iq score required for admission to mensa is 128. 9(a) find the mean and the standard deviation of iq scores. round your answers to the nearest whole numbers. hint. find z-scores.

Answers

The mean IQ score in the population is approximately 98, and the standard deviation is approximately 16.

Let μ = mean and σ = standard deviation of IQ scores in population.

Then we can write the two equations as :

⇒ P(X ≤ 80) = 0.13    ...equation(1)

⇒ P(X ≥ 128) = 0.03   ...equation(2)

we standardize the data by using the formula:

⇒ Z = (X - μ)/σ,

Where Z = standard normal variable.

Using the standard normal distribution, we know that P(Z ≤ -1.126) = 0.13,

So, -1.126 = (80 - μ)/σ   .....equation(3),

and we know that P(Z ≥ 1.881) = 0.03.

So, 1.88 = (128 - μ)/σ     ...equation(4),

⇒ μ = 128 - 1.881σ,

Solving equation(3) and equation(4),

We get,

⇒ σ ≈ 16.

Substituting σ = 16 into the equation(4),

We get,

⇒ μ = 128 - 1.881×16,

⇒ μ = 98.

Therefore, the mean IQ score = 98, and standard deviation is = 16.
